This trailblazing book does more than just cover the new syntax in COBOL-97, it stresses the design that must be done before a COBOL program is written. The text builds on software engineering principles and practices combined with object-oriented technology to enable effective use of this latest form of COBOL. Contains a series of major examples, conveyed from design to code, with each step carefully explained.
